This tool maps the corresponding waveforms onto the points in the F5-file. Therefore, beside the F5-file itself, also the waveform-files (".wfm" or a "wff5.f5-file" exported from RXP) need to be specified. Please note that the ".wfm.idx" file needs to be in the same folder as the ".wfm", but only the ".wfm" has to be added to the input list. The F5-files and waveform-files don't have to be in the same folder, but the basename of the waveform-file (the filename before the dot or in case of a wff5-file the filename before the '_wff5.f5') must be part of the F5-file's basename, otherwise the app cannot match them. E.g. "123456_654321_Channel_G.wfm" would match both, "123456_654321_Channel_G_1.f5" and "workingcopy_123456_654321_Channel_G_0.f5"

The ratio of waveforms found per point is recorded in the logfile and saved as attribute "Waveforms found ratio" on the corresponding fragments of the field "Waveforms.DirectionDelta" in the F5-file. Please note that a value of 1.0 can only be reached in rare cases as not 100% of all waveforms are saved to the RXP by the scanner. Values above 0.95 are usually the maximum that can be achieved. If you encounter values smaller than 0.1 then your scanner might be calibrated wrongly. In this case please contact your scanner's manufacturer and ask for the correct reference time. Use this reference time via the t_ref option (see above).
